#d0d4e5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d0d4e5 is composed of 81.6% red, 83.1% green and 89.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 9.2% cyan, 7.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 228.6 degrees, a saturation of 28.8% and a lightness of 85.7%. #d0d4e5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a1a9cb.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

#d0d4e5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d0d4e5 has RGB values of R:208, G:212, B:229 and CMYK values of C:0.09, M:0.07, Y:0,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 13685989.
